About us

WithYou provides free and confidential support, without judgment, to over 100,000 people annually across England and Scotland, addressing issues related to drugs, alcohol, and mental health. Our name reflects our mission: a positive environment where individuals can progress, connect, and receive expert help tailored to their needs.
